    Wireless Intertnet Can't Renew IP address
    Hi,
    So I bought a used laptop: it's a Latitude D505 with XP.
    When I try to connect to my wireless internet, which works on my other DELL computer, the symbol in the task bar that it has an excellent connection.
    However, when I go into Internet Explorer, it says that I am not connected to the internet.
    I tried right-clicking on the wireless internet symbol and clicking repair, and it said that it could not renew my IP address.
    What do I do to connect to my internet? Please help! Thank you! :]

    Click on Start, Control Panel and look for Dell Wireless Utilities. At the top of the settings in the Wireless Networks tab, you will see a checkbox for Let this tool manage your wireless settings. Is this, checked? If it is, the Windows Wireless Network Configuration Wizard is NOT in control of your wireless adapter. You will need to use the Dell utility to connect to your wireless networks. Look in the Link Status tab for more information regarding yor connection.

    If you have previous connections in the list of Preferred Networks, delete them all so that you will know if your wireless card is connecting to your connection and not trying to connect to someone else's.
